How Do GMC Sierra Power Folding Mirrors Work?

Before troubleshooting a malfunction, it helps to understand how the power folding mirror system operates. The system is not controlled by a single motor alone. Instead, several electrical and mechanical components work together to fold and unfold the mirrors smoothly whenever the driver presses the mirror fold button or activates the automatic folding feature.

The process begins with the mirror control switch located on the driver’s door panel. When the switch is activated, it sends an electrical signal to the Door Control Module (DCM). The DCM communicates with the Body Control Module (BCM), which verifies that operating conditions are correct before supplying power to the mirror actuator and folding motor.

Inside each mirror housing is a compact electric motor connected to a gear-driven actuator. The motor provides the rotational force, while the actuator converts that force into the movement needed to fold or unfold the mirror. Because the gears are subjected to repeated use and changing weather conditions, they are among the most common components to wear over time.

Power reaches the mirrors through a dedicated wiring harness that passes from the vehicle body into the driver’s and passenger’s doors. Since these wires flex every time the doors are opened and closed, they can eventually crack or break internally. Even a single damaged wire may interrupt communication or prevent the motor from receiving enough voltage to operate correctly.

A dedicated fuse protects the entire mirror circuit from electrical overload. If excessive current flows because of a short circuit or a seized motor, the fuse blows to prevent further damage. Replacing the fuse may restore operation, but if it blows again immediately, there is usually a deeper electrical issue that needs attention.

Many newer GMC Sierra models also include memory mirrors. These systems store preferred mirror positions for different drivers and automatically return the mirrors to their saved positions after the vehicle is unlocked. The memory function works alongside the power folding feature, meaning software glitches or calibration errors can sometimes cause folding problems even when the mechanical components remain in good condition.

Because multiple electronic modules, motors, sensors, and wiring connections are involved, diagnosing a power folding mirror problem requires a systematic approach. Understanding how each component contributes to the system makes it much easier to identify whether the fault is mechanical, electrical, or software related.

Symptoms of a Faulty Power Folding Mirror

Power folding mirror problems rarely appear without warning. In many cases, the mirrors begin showing intermittent issues before failing completely. Recognizing these symptoms can help narrow down the source of the problem and prevent unnecessary replacement of expensive components.

One of the most common symptoms is that the mirrors no longer fold when the control button is pressed. The mirrors may remain completely stationary, even though other mirror functions such as glass adjustment or heating continue to work normally. This often points to a failed folding motor, damaged wiring, or a blown fuse.

Another frequent complaint is that only one mirror folds while the other remains fixed. When only the driver’s side or passenger’s side mirror is affected, the issue is usually isolated to that mirror assembly, its wiring, or its actuator rather than the entire control system.

Some owners notice that the mirrors begin folding but stop halfway through the movement. This symptom often indicates worn internal gears, excessive resistance caused by dirt or corrosion, or a weakening motor that no longer produces enough torque to complete the folding cycle.

Clicking noises coming from inside the mirror housing are another common warning sign. The sound usually comes from stripped plastic gears or a damaged actuator attempting to move the mirror. Although the motor is still receiving power, the mechanical components inside the mirror cannot transfer that power effectively.

Grinding noises are generally more serious because they indicate metal or plastic components rubbing against each other inside the mirror assembly. Continued operation under these conditions can permanently damage the motor and gear mechanism.

Some mirrors unfold unexpectedly after being folded or repeatedly cycle between folded and unfolded positions. This behavior often results from faulty position sensors, software calibration issues, or communication problems between the Door Control Module and the Body Control Module.

Cold weather may introduce another symptom where the mirrors appear completely stuck during freezing temperatures. Ice accumulation around the pivot point can prevent normal movement even when the electrical system is functioning properly. Attempting to force the mirrors open by hand in these conditions may damage the actuator or break internal gears.

Intermittent operation is often the most difficult symptom to diagnose. The mirrors may work perfectly for several days before suddenly failing again. This usually suggests loose electrical connectors, partially broken wiring inside the door hinge area, moisture intrusion, or an electronic control module beginning to fail.

Carefully observing exactly how the mirrors behave provides valuable diagnostic clues. Whether the mirrors make noise, stop halfway, work only on one side, or fail completely will help determine which component should be inspected first.

12 Common Causes of GMC Sierra Power Folding Mirrors Not Working

1. Blown Fuse

A blown fuse is one of the simplest and most common reasons why GMC Sierra power folding mirrors stop working. Every electrical circuit in the vehicle is protected by fuses designed to interrupt power when excessive current is detected. This protection prevents overheating, damaged wiring, and potential electrical fires.

When the mirror fuse blows, the folding function usually stops working immediately. Depending on the vehicle configuration, other mirror features such as glass adjustment or heating may continue to operate because they are protected by separate circuits. This often confuses owners into believing the mirror motor has failed when the actual problem is only a small fuse.

Several factors can cause the mirror fuse to fail. A seized mirror motor that draws excessive current is one possibility. Damaged wiring inside the door harness can also create a short circuit that instantly blows the fuse. Water intrusion inside the mirror housing or corrosion in electrical connectors may also increase electrical resistance and overload the circuit.

To inspect the fuse, locate the fuse box specified in your GMC Sierra owner’s manual. Remove the designated mirror fuse using a fuse puller and examine the metal strip inside. If the strip is broken or burned, replace the fuse with another one of exactly the same amperage rating. Never install a higher-rated fuse because doing so removes the circuit’s designed protection and may cause severe electrical damage.

If the replacement fuse blows again shortly after installation, avoid repeatedly replacing it. A recurring blown fuse almost always indicates an underlying electrical fault that requires further diagnosis, such as damaged wiring, a shorted mirror motor, or a malfunctioning control module.

Checking the fuse should always be the first troubleshooting step because it requires only a few minutes and may solve the problem without the need for expensive repairs.

2. Faulty Mirror Switch

The mirror control switch serves as the driver’s primary interface with the power folding mirror system. Every time the fold button is pressed, the switch sends an electrical signal requesting the Door Control Module to activate the mirror motors. If the switch fails internally, that signal may never reach the control module, leaving the mirrors completely unresponsive.

Like any frequently used electrical component, the mirror switch experiences wear over time. Thousands of button presses, exposure to dust, spilled liquids, humidity, and temperature changes can gradually damage the internal contacts. In some cases, oxidation builds up on the contacts, creating increased electrical resistance that causes intermittent operation.

Common symptoms of a faulty mirror switch include mirrors that respond only after pressing the button multiple times, mirrors that work only in one direction, or a complete loss of the folding function while other electrical systems continue operating normally. Sometimes applying pressure at a specific angle temporarily restores operation, another indication that the internal contacts are worn.

Diagnosing the switch begins with a careful visual inspection. Check for loose buttons, cracked plastic, signs of liquid damage, or excessive dirt around the switch assembly. A multimeter can then be used to verify continuity while the button is pressed. If the switch fails to provide consistent electrical continuity, replacement is usually the most reliable solution.

Fortunately, replacing the mirror switch is generally straightforward. The driver’s door trim panel or switch bezel is removed, the electrical connector is unplugged, and a new OEM or high-quality replacement switch is installed. Once installed, the system typically requires no additional programming, allowing normal mirror operation to resume immediately if the switch was the source of the problem.

3. Bad Mirror Motor

The mirror motor is the component responsible for generating the mechanical force that folds and unfolds the mirror assembly. Every time the folding feature is activated, the motor rotates a series of gears connected to the actuator. Because it performs the actual physical movement, it is one of the hardest-working parts of the entire mirror system.

Over years of operation, the electric motor gradually wears out. Internal brushes can deteriorate, bearings may develop excessive friction, and moisture can enter the motor housing through damaged seals. Exposure to rain, road salt, snow, and repeated temperature fluctuations accelerates corrosion and reduces the motor’s lifespan.

A failing mirror motor often produces noticeable warning signs before it stops working completely. You may hear a humming sound without any mirror movement, indicating that the motor is receiving power but lacks sufficient torque to move the mechanism. In other cases, the motor may operate very slowly, stop midway through the folding cycle, or require several attempts before completing the movement. Eventually, the motor may become completely silent, signaling total internal failure.

Testing the mirror motor usually involves removing the mirror assembly and checking whether voltage reaches the motor connector when the fold button is pressed. If the correct voltage is present but the motor fails to operate, the motor itself is likely defective. If no voltage reaches the connector, the fault is more likely located in the wiring, switch, fuse, or control module.

Because the mirror motor is integrated into the mirror assembly on many GMC Sierra models, replacing it may require partial disassembly of the mirror housing or, in some cases, replacement of the complete mirror assembly. Although this repair is more expensive than replacing a fuse or switch, installing a quality OEM component helps restore reliable operation and reduces the likelihood of future failures caused by inferior aftermarket parts.

4. Broken Mirror Actuator

While the mirror motor provides the rotational force, the actuator is responsible for converting that force into the precise movement that folds and unfolds the mirror. Inside the actuator are several plastic and metal gears that work together to move the mirror smoothly. After years of repeated use, these gears can wear down, crack, or even break completely.

A damaged actuator often produces symptoms that differ slightly from those of a failed motor. For example, you may hear the motor running normally, but the mirror barely moves or does not move at all. This occurs because the motor is still generating power, but the damaged gears are no longer capable of transferring that power to the mirror housing.

Plastic gears are particularly vulnerable to wear because they experience constant stress every time the mirrors are folded. Cold temperatures can make the plastic more brittle, increasing the likelihood of cracked or stripped teeth. Dirt, road debris, and dried lubricant inside the hinge mechanism can also increase resistance, forcing the actuator to work harder than intended and accelerating gear wear.

In some situations, the actuator may partially fail, allowing the mirror to fold only halfway before becoming stuck. The mirror might also require several button presses before completing its movement, indicating that the internal gears are slipping under load.

Inspecting the actuator generally requires removing the mirror housing. Once opened, look for broken gear teeth, excessive play in the linkage, damaged pivot components, or signs of corrosion. If significant internal damage is found, replacing the actuator is usually more reliable than attempting to repair individual gears.

Using an OEM actuator helps ensure smooth operation and proper compatibility with the mirror’s electronic control system. Although some aftermarket repair kits include replacement gears, their long-term durability may vary depending on material quality and manufacturing precision.

5. Wiring Damage in the Door Harness

Electrical wiring problems are among the most overlooked causes of power folding mirror failures. Every time the driver’s or passenger’s door is opened and closed, the wiring harness that connects the door to the vehicle body bends repeatedly. After thousands of cycles, individual wires inside the protective rubber boot may begin to crack or break internally.

Unlike a completely disconnected wire, a partially broken conductor can create intermittent electrical problems that are difficult to diagnose. The mirrors may function normally one day and fail the next depending on door position, temperature, or vibration while driving.

Broken wires commonly interrupt power delivery to the mirror motor or disrupt communication between the mirror switch, Door Control Module, and Body Control Module. As a result, the mirrors may stop responding, operate only occasionally, or work only when the door is held in a certain position.

Moisture intrusion can make the problem even worse. If water enters the rubber boot or electrical connectors, corrosion gradually develops on the terminals. Corroded connections increase electrical resistance, reducing the voltage available to the mirror motor. Even a small voltage drop may prevent the motor from generating enough torque to fold the mirrors properly.

Diagnosing wiring damage begins with a careful visual inspection of the flexible rubber conduit between the door and the vehicle body. Pull the boot back gently and examine each wire for cracked insulation, stretched conductors, corrosion, or signs of previous repairs. A multimeter can then be used to perform continuity testing on individual circuits while gently flexing the harness to reveal intermittent breaks.

If damaged wiring is discovered, replacing the affected section or installing a manufacturer-approved repair harness is recommended. Twisting wires together with electrical tape may provide only a temporary solution and often leads to recurring problems due to vibration and moisture exposure.

Properly repaired wiring restores stable voltage and reliable communication throughout the mirror system, eliminating one of the most common hidden causes of intermittent mirror operation.

6. Loose Electrical Connector

Even when the wiring itself is in good condition, a loose or contaminated electrical connector can prevent the power folding mirrors from operating correctly. Every connection in the mirror system relies on clean, secure electrical contact to deliver power and communication signals between the switch, control modules, and mirror motor.

Over time, connectors can loosen because of vibration, repeated door movement, or previous repair work. Moisture entering the connector may also lead to corrosion on the terminals. Corrosion creates additional electrical resistance, reducing the amount of current reaching the mirror motor and causing inconsistent operation.

A loose connector often produces intermittent symptoms. The mirrors may function normally after starting the vehicle but suddenly stop responding later in the drive. In some cases, lightly closing the door or driving over rough roads may temporarily restore or interrupt operation as the connector shifts position.

When inspecting connectors, disconnect the battery if recommended by the service manual, then unplug each connector associated with the mirror assembly and door wiring. Examine both sides for bent pins, green or white corrosion deposits, dirt, moisture, or signs of overheating such as melted plastic. Any damaged terminals should be replaced rather than forced back into position.

Cleaning mildly corroded connectors with an approved electrical contact cleaner and allowing them to dry completely before reconnecting can often restore reliable electrical contact. Applying a small amount of dielectric grease to the terminals also helps protect against future moisture intrusion without interfering with electrical conductivity.

After reconnecting each connector, ensure that the locking tabs engage fully. A connector that appears connected but is not completely seated may still create intermittent faults that are difficult to reproduce during diagnosis.

Because connector issues can mimic more serious electrical failures, they should always be inspected before replacing expensive components such as the mirror motor, actuator, Door Control Module, or Body Control Module. Spending a few minutes checking every connection may save hundreds of dollars in unnecessary repairs.

7. Door Control Module Failure

The Door Control Module (DCM) plays a critical role in the operation of your GMC Sierra’s power folding mirrors. Rather than sending power directly from the mirror switch to the mirror motor, the system relies on the DCM to interpret the driver’s command and coordinate communication with the Body Control Module (BCM). Once the request is verified, the DCM activates the appropriate circuit that powers the mirror motor.

When the Door Control Module begins to fail, the mirror system can display a wide range of unpredictable symptoms. The mirrors may stop responding completely, fold only occasionally, or operate with noticeable delays after pressing the switch. In some cases, one mirror functions normally while the other remains inoperative because each door has its own control electronics.

A faulty DCM may also affect other door-related features. If your power windows, power locks, memory seats, mirror adjustment, or puddle lights begin acting abnormally at the same time, the problem is more likely related to the module rather than the mirror assembly itself.

Electrical damage is one of the leading causes of DCM failure. Water intrusion inside the door panel, corrosion on module connectors, voltage spikes from a weak battery, or damaged wiring can all interfere with normal module operation. Internal electronic components may also fail simply because of age and prolonged exposure to heat and vibration.

Diagnosing a defective Door Control Module usually requires a professional scan tool capable of communicating with the vehicle’s onboard control network. Diagnostic Trouble Codes (DTCs) related to door electronics, communication failures, or mirror control circuits can help identify whether the module is functioning correctly.

Before replacing the DCM, technicians typically verify that power, ground, and communication signals are present at the module connectors. Replacing the module without confirming these basic electrical conditions may not solve the problem if the real issue lies elsewhere in the wiring harness.

If replacement becomes necessary, the new Door Control Module often requires programming or configuration using GM-approved diagnostic equipment. Without proper programming, the module may not communicate correctly with the BCM or recognize vehicle-specific features such as memory mirrors and automatic folding functions.

Because module replacement involves both hardware and software, it is generally recommended only after simpler causes such as blown fuses, damaged wiring, loose connectors, and faulty mirror switches have been ruled out.

8. BCM Software Issue

Not every power folding mirror problem is caused by a broken mechanical component. In many newer GMC Sierra models, software plays an equally important role in controlling electronic features. The Body Control Module (BCM) acts as the central controller for numerous vehicle systems, including lighting, security, keyless entry, memory settings, and power folding mirrors.

Occasionally, software errors inside the BCM can interrupt communication between the mirror switch, Door Control Module, and mirror motors. When this happens, the mirrors may stop responding even though every electrical and mechanical component remains in good working condition.

One common symptom of a BCM software issue is intermittent mirror operation. The mirrors may work perfectly after starting the truck, then suddenly stop functioning after several minutes of driving. In other cases, the mirrors may fail only after disconnecting the battery, replacing electrical components, or updating vehicle settings.

Memory mirror functions can also become affected. The mirrors may no longer return to their saved positions, automatic folding when locking the vehicle may stop working, or driver profiles may fail to recall mirror settings correctly.

Manufacturers periodically release software updates that address known electronic issues discovered after vehicles enter production. These updates may improve communication between modules, correct programming errors, or resolve intermittent faults that cannot be repaired by replacing physical components.

If a software issue is suspected, a dealership or qualified repair facility can connect the vehicle to GM’s diagnostic system to check the current BCM software version. If an update is available, reprogramming the module may restore normal mirror operation without replacing any hardware.

In some situations, a simple module reset can temporarily resolve software glitches. Disconnecting the battery for several minutes or performing the manufacturer’s recommended reset procedure may clear temporary faults. However, if the problem repeatedly returns, a permanent software update is usually the better solution.

Ignoring software-related issues may eventually affect additional electronic systems beyond the mirrors. For this reason, keeping the BCM updated according to manufacturer recommendations helps ensure reliable operation of the vehicle’s increasingly sophisticated electrical systems.

9. Frozen or Dirty Mirror Pivot

Environmental conditions can have a significant impact on the performance of power folding mirrors. Even when every electrical component is functioning correctly, the mirrors may still refuse to fold if the pivot mechanism becomes obstructed by dirt, ice, corrosion, or hardened debris.

The mirror pivot is designed to move smoothly through a limited range of motion. Over time, dust, road grime, tree sap, mud, and salt accumulate around the hinge area. These contaminants gradually increase friction, forcing the mirror motor and actuator to work harder each time the mirrors fold or unfold.

Winter conditions create an even greater challenge. Snow and freezing rain can cause ice to form around the mirror pivot. If the folding function is activated while the mirror is frozen in place, the motor may stall or repeatedly attempt to move the mirror without success. Continued operation under these conditions places excessive stress on the gears and actuator, increasing the risk of permanent mechanical damage.

Owners often mistake a frozen mirror for an electrical failure because pressing the fold button produces little or no movement. In some cases, a faint humming sound can be heard as the motor struggles against the frozen mechanism. Repeated clicking noises may indicate that the gears are slipping because the mirror cannot rotate.

Inspect the pivot area carefully for visible dirt, corrosion, or ice buildup. If ice is present, avoid forcing the mirror by hand. Instead, allow the vehicle to warm up naturally or use a safe automotive de-icing product specifically designed for exterior components. Excessive force can crack the mirror housing or strip the internal gears.

After cleaning the pivot, apply a high-quality silicone-based lubricant to the moving parts. Silicone lubricants repel moisture without attracting dirt, making them ideal for exterior automotive components. Avoid heavy grease products because they tend to collect dust and debris over time, eventually creating even greater resistance.

Regular cleaning during routine vehicle washing can significantly extend the life of the folding mechanism. Removing accumulated road salt and debris before they harden reduces stress on the motor and actuator while helping the mirrors continue operating smoothly throughout the year.

By including periodic inspection and lubrication of the mirror pivot in your maintenance routine, you can prevent many folding mirror problems before they develop into expensive repairs.

10. Mirror Memory Calibration Lost

Many GMC Sierra models equipped with power folding mirrors also include a memory mirror system. This feature allows the vehicle to store personalized mirror positions for multiple drivers and automatically restore those settings when a specific key fob or driver profile is detected. While convenient, the system depends on accurate calibration. If that calibration is lost, the mirrors may stop folding correctly or behave unpredictably.

Calibration issues often occur after replacing the battery, disconnecting electrical power for an extended period, installing a new mirror assembly, or updating the Body Control Module software. In some cases, calibration data may become corrupted because of a temporary electronic fault, causing the mirrors to lose track of their fully folded and fully extended positions.

When calibration is lost, the mirrors may stop before reaching their intended position, fold farther than normal, repeatedly attempt to adjust themselves, or refuse to respond altogether. Some owners also report that the mirrors fold normally but fail to unfold completely, reducing rearward visibility while driving.

Fortunately, recalibrating the mirror system is often much simpler than replacing components. Depending on the GMC Sierra model year, the process may involve cycling the ignition, operating the mirror fold switch several times, or resetting the memory seat and mirror settings through the vehicle’s infotainment system. Some models automatically relearn mirror positions after completing several full folding and unfolding cycles.

If the calibration procedure does not restore normal operation, the issue may involve the mirror position sensor, Door Control Module, or Body Control Module rather than the stored memory settings. At that point, a diagnostic scan is recommended to identify any stored fault codes related to the mirror system.

Maintaining proper calibration is especially important for vehicles equipped with automatic folding mirrors, memory seating packages, and driver profile recognition. Ensuring these systems remain synchronized improves convenience while reducing unnecessary stress on the folding mechanism.

11. Damaged Mirror Assembly

Sometimes the cause of a power folding mirror failure is simply physical damage. Even a relatively minor impact can affect the delicate mechanical and electrical components contained inside the mirror assembly. While exterior damage may be obvious after an accident, internal damage often goes unnoticed until the folding mechanism begins to malfunction.

Parking lot collisions are among the most common causes of mirror damage. Another vehicle, a garage wall, a fence, or even a low-hanging obstacle can strike the mirror with enough force to bend the internal linkage without completely breaking the outer housing. As a result, the mirror may still appear normal but struggle to fold correctly.

A damaged mirror assembly may exhibit several warning signs. The mirror housing may feel loose when moved by hand, the folding motion may appear uneven, or unusual gaps may develop between the mirror and its mounting base. Clicking, binding, or grinding sounds during operation often indicate internal mechanical damage.

Cracks in the mirror housing can also allow water to enter the assembly. Moisture accelerates corrosion of electrical connectors, damages the mirror motor, and contaminates the actuator gears. Over time, this secondary damage may become more severe than the original impact itself.

Inspect the mirror carefully for signs of physical distortion, cracked plastic, broken mounting tabs, or loose components. Compare the affected mirror with the opposite side to identify differences in alignment or movement. If the mirror housing no longer sits squarely against the door, internal structural damage is likely.

Although individual internal parts can sometimes be replaced, many damaged mirror assemblies require complete replacement to restore factory performance. Installing a complete OEM mirror assembly ensures proper alignment, electrical compatibility, and reliable operation of all integrated features, including heating, turn signals, blind spot monitoring, cameras, memory functions, and power folding capability.

Choosing high-quality replacement parts is particularly important because poorly manufactured aftermarket mirrors may introduce new problems such as excessive vibration, poor fitment, or unreliable electronic performance.

12. Aftermarket Mirror Compatibility Problems

Not all replacement mirrors are built to the same standards as the original equipment installed by GMC. While aftermarket mirrors often cost significantly less than OEM components, some are not fully compatible with the vehicle’s electrical architecture. This incompatibility can lead to a variety of power folding mirror problems that are difficult to diagnose.

Many modern GMC Sierra trucks use sophisticated communication networks between the Body Control Module, Door Control Module, and mirror assembly. Premium trim levels may include additional features such as memory positioning, automatic folding, heated mirrors, turn signal indicators, puddle lamps, blind spot monitoring, surround view cameras, and power extending functions. A replacement mirror that lacks support for one or more of these features may not communicate correctly with the vehicle.

Owners frequently encounter compatibility issues after installing inexpensive aftermarket mirrors purchased online. Common symptoms include mirrors that refuse to fold, operate only in one direction, fold much more slowly than the original mirrors, or trigger warning messages on the instrument cluster.

Incorrect wiring is another common issue. Although the electrical connector may physically fit the vehicle, the internal pin configuration may differ from the OEM design. Even one incorrectly wired terminal can prevent the folding motor from receiving the correct signals or interfere with communication between control modules.

Build quality also varies widely among aftermarket manufacturers. Lower-quality motors, weaker actuators, and less durable gears may function properly immediately after installation but fail prematurely after only a short period of regular use.

Before replacing a mirror, verify that the replacement part matches your truck’s exact model year, trim level, and factory option package. Pay particular attention to features such as memory mirrors, power folding capability, towing mirrors, camera systems, and blind spot monitoring. Using the vehicle identification number when ordering parts helps reduce the risk of purchasing an incompatible assembly.

If power folding mirror problems begin immediately after installing a replacement mirror, compatibility should be considered before diagnosing more complex electrical faults. Reinstalling the original mirror, if available, can quickly determine whether the new component is the source of the problem.

Selecting OEM mirrors or premium aftermarket products from reputable manufacturers may involve a higher initial investment, but they typically provide better fit, longer service life, and full compatibility with the GMC Sierra’s electronic systems.

Step by Step Troubleshooting Guide

Finding the exact cause of a power folding mirror failure does not have to involve replacing parts at random. A systematic troubleshooting process allows you to identify the problem efficiently while minimizing unnecessary repair costs. Begin with the simplest inspections before moving on to more advanced electrical diagnostics.

Step 1: Check the Fuse

Start by locating the fuse that protects the power folding mirror circuit. Refer to your owner’s manual or the fuse box diagram to identify the correct fuse. Remove it carefully and inspect the metal element inside. If the fuse has blown, replace it with one of the same amperage rating. If the replacement fuse fails immediately, stop testing and investigate for a short circuit or failed mirror motor.

Step 2: Test the Mirror Switch

Press the mirror fold button several times while listening for any response from the mirrors. If nothing happens, inspect the switch for physical damage or contamination. A multimeter can be used to verify whether the switch sends the proper signal when activated. If the switch fails continuity testing, replacement is usually the most effective solution.

Step 3: Inspect the Wiring

Examine the wiring harness between the door and the vehicle body. Pull back the rubber boot and look for cracked insulation, broken wires, corrosion, or previous repair work. Flex the harness gently while operating the mirror switch because intermittent wiring faults often appear only when the harness moves.

Step 4: Listen for Motor Noise

Press the fold button and pay close attention to any sounds coming from the mirror housing. A humming motor without mirror movement often points to a damaged actuator or stripped gears. Complete silence may indicate a blown fuse, faulty switch, damaged wiring, or lack of electrical power reaching the motor.

Step 5: Check Mirror Movement Manually

With the ignition turned off, gently move the mirror by hand according to the manufacturer’s recommendations. The mirror should move smoothly without excessive resistance. If the mechanism feels stiff or binds during movement, inspect the pivot for dirt, corrosion, or physical damage. Never force a frozen mirror because doing so may damage the internal gears.

Step 6: Reset the Mirror System

If all visible components appear normal, perform a mirror reset procedure. Cycle the ignition, fold and unfold the mirrors several times, and restore any memory mirror settings if equipped. Some vehicles automatically recalibrate after several complete operating cycles.

Step 7: Scan for Diagnostic Trouble Codes

If the mirrors still fail to operate correctly, connect a professional diagnostic scanner capable of communicating with the Body Control Module and Door Control Module. Stored Diagnostic Trouble Codes can identify communication failures, module faults, sensor errors, or electrical problems that are impossible to detect through visual inspection alone.

Following these troubleshooting steps in order helps eliminate simple causes before progressing to more advanced repairs. This logical approach not only saves time but also reduces the likelihood of replacing expensive components that are still functioning properly.

How to Reset GMC Sierra Power Folding Mirrors

If your GMC Sierra power folding mirrors suddenly stop working after a battery replacement, electrical repair, or software update, performing a system reset may restore normal operation. Resetting the mirrors is also worthwhile when the mirrors operate inconsistently, stop midway through the folding cycle, or fail to return to their correct positions. Since the procedure requires only a few minutes, it should be attempted before replacing expensive components.

Method 1: Ignition Reset

One of the simplest reset procedures involves cycling the vehicle’s ignition.

Turn the ignition to the ON position without starting the engine. Press and hold the power folding mirror button until the mirrors complete their movement. Wait a few seconds, then press the button again to return the mirrors to their normal driving position. Repeat this process three to five times.

During these repeated cycles, the control modules may relearn the mirror travel limits and restore proper synchronization between the folding motors and position sensors.

Method 2: Battery Disconnect Reset

Temporary software glitches inside the Body Control Module can sometimes be cleared by disconnecting the battery.

Turn off the ignition and remove the negative battery cable. Wait approximately 10 to 15 minutes to allow stored electrical energy to dissipate. Reconnect the battery securely and start the vehicle.

Operate the power folding mirrors several times to determine whether normal operation has returned. If the mirrors now function correctly, the issue may have been caused by temporary software corruption rather than mechanical failure.

Keep in mind that disconnecting the battery may erase other stored settings, including radio presets, clock settings, and memory seat positions.

Method 3: Mirror Calibration Procedure

If the mirrors fold unevenly or fail to stop at the correct position, recalibration may be necessary.

With the ignition switched on, press the folding mirror button and allow the mirrors to fold completely. Once fully folded, wait several seconds before unfolding them again. Perform several complete folding and unfolding cycles without interrupting the movement.

Some GMC Sierra models automatically store the fully folded and fully extended positions during this process, allowing the system to regain accurate positioning.

Method 4: Reset Memory Mirror Settings

Vehicles equipped with memory seats often integrate mirror positioning into the same memory profile.

Open the vehicle settings menu through the infotainment system or use the memory seat buttons located on the driver’s door. Save a new mirror position or overwrite the existing memory profile. After storing the new settings, test both the memory recall function and the power folding feature.

If resetting the memory profile restores normal operation, the issue was likely related to corrupted calibration data rather than a hardware malfunction.

If none of these reset procedures resolve the problem, further diagnosis is recommended. Persistent mirror failures usually indicate a faulty mirror motor, damaged actuator, wiring problem, Door Control Module issue, or Body Control Module malfunction.

Estimated Repair Costs

Repair costs for GMC Sierra power folding mirrors vary considerably depending on the failed component, labor rates in your area, and whether OEM or aftermarket parts are used. Fortunately, many problems can be resolved with relatively inexpensive repairs if diagnosed early.

RepairEstimated Cost (USD)
Fuse replacement$10 to $30
Mirror switch replacement$80 to $180
Wiring repair$100 to $300
Mirror motor replacement$180 to $400
Mirror actuator replacement$200 to $450
Complete mirror assembly$350 to $900
Door Control Module replacement$250 to $600
BCM software update$100 to $250
BCM replacement and programming$500 to $1,200

Labor costs account for a significant portion of many mirror repairs. Replacing a fuse or mirror switch may require less than one hour of labor, while replacing a complete mirror assembly or repairing damaged door wiring can take several hours.

Vehicles equipped with advanced features such as memory mirrors, blind spot monitoring, surround view cameras, integrated turn signals, or power extending towing mirrors typically have higher replacement costs because these systems require additional sensors, wiring, and programming.

Before authorizing major repairs, request a complete diagnosis rather than replacing parts based solely on symptoms. For example, replacing an entire mirror assembly when the real problem is a damaged wiring harness or loose connector can add hundreds of dollars in unnecessary expense.

If your GMC Sierra is still covered by the factory warranty or an extended service contract, verify whether mirror-related repairs are included. Electrical components and control modules may qualify for coverage depending on the vehicle’s age, mileage, and warranty terms.

Can You Drive with a Broken Folding Mirror?

Whether you can safely continue driving depends on the specific nature of the mirror problem. In many cases, a power folding mirror failure affects convenience rather than basic vehicle operation. However, certain mirror malfunctions can reduce visibility, create safety concerns, and even violate local traffic regulations.

If the mirrors remain fully extended and provide a clear rearward view, the vehicle is generally safe to drive for a short period while repairs are scheduled. The primary inconvenience is that the mirrors can no longer fold automatically when parking in narrow spaces or entering garages.

The situation becomes more serious if one mirror remains partially folded or cannot be adjusted into the proper driving position. Reduced visibility significantly increases blind spots, making lane changes, merging, and reversing more dangerous.

Drivers who regularly tow trailers should be especially cautious. Proper mirror positioning is essential for monitoring traffic behind the trailer. A malfunctioning folding mirror or towing mirror can limit visibility and make towing considerably less safe.

Loose mirrors should also be repaired promptly. A mirror that vibrates excessively while driving reduces image clarity and may continue to deteriorate over time. In severe cases, damaged mounting brackets can allow the mirror assembly to detach from the vehicle.

Some jurisdictions require both side mirrors to be functional if the rearview mirror does not provide an unobstructed view. Driving with damaged mirrors may therefore result in inspection failures or traffic citations depending on local regulations.

If the mirror housing has suffered collision damage, inspect it carefully for sharp edges, exposed wiring, or loose components that could create additional hazards for pedestrians or other vehicles.

Although you may be able to continue driving temporarily, delaying repairs increases the likelihood of further damage. A small electrical fault, worn actuator, or loose connector can eventually lead to complete system failure and significantly higher repair costs.

Preventive Maintenance Tips

Regular maintenance can greatly extend the lifespan of your GMC Sierra’s power folding mirror system. Many common failures develop gradually and can be prevented with routine inspection and proper care.

Clean the mirror hinge area regularly to remove dirt, mud, road salt, and other debris that accumulate around the pivot mechanism. Keeping this area clean reduces friction and allows the mirrors to fold smoothly without placing unnecessary strain on the motor and actuator.

Apply a silicone-based lubricant to the pivot points several times each year, particularly before winter. Silicone lubricants repel moisture while providing smooth operation without attracting excessive dust and dirt.

Never force a frozen mirror to move by hand. If ice has formed around the hinge, allow it to thaw naturally or use an approved automotive de-icer before activating the folding mechanism. Forcing the mirror can strip internal gears or permanently damage the actuator.

Inspect the wiring harness between the door and vehicle body during routine maintenance. Look for cracked insulation, damaged rubber boots, or signs of corrosion that could eventually interrupt electrical communication.

Wash road salt from the mirrors and door area frequently during winter months. Salt accelerates corrosion on electrical connectors, mounting hardware, and internal mechanical components.

Operate the folding mirrors periodically even if you rarely use the feature. Regular movement helps distribute lubricant throughout the mechanism and reduces the chance of components seizing after long periods of inactivity.

Keep your vehicle’s software updated according to GMC service recommendations. Periodic updates for the Body Control Module and other electronic systems may improve communication between modules and correct known software-related issues affecting mirror operation.

If your vehicle is equipped with memory mirrors, recalibrate the system whenever major electrical work is performed or after replacing the battery. Maintaining accurate calibration helps prevent unnecessary stress on the folding mechanism and ensures consistent operation.

A few minutes of preventive maintenance several times a year can significantly reduce the risk of unexpected mirror failures while helping you avoid costly repairs in the future.

Frequently Asked Questions

Why are my GMC Sierra power folding mirrors not working?

There are several possible reasons why your GMC Sierra power folding mirrors have stopped working. The most common causes include a blown fuse, a faulty mirror switch, damaged wiring inside the door harness, a worn mirror motor, a broken actuator, or software issues affecting the Body Control Module. Environmental factors such as ice buildup, dirt, or corrosion around the mirror pivot can also prevent the mirrors from folding properly. A systematic inspection starting with the fuse and wiring is usually the fastest way to identify the problem.

Why does only one power folding mirror work?

If only one mirror folds while the other remains stationary, the problem is typically isolated to the affected side. Possible causes include a failed mirror motor, damaged actuator gears, broken wiring inside the door, a loose electrical connector, or physical damage to the mirror assembly. Since each mirror has its own motor and mechanical components, a failure on one side does not necessarily indicate a problem with the entire system.

Can I manually fold a power folding mirror?

Yes, most GMC Sierra power folding mirrors can be folded manually in an emergency. However, you should always move the mirror gently and follow the recommendations in your owner’s manual. Forcing the mirror while the actuator is jammed or frozen may damage the internal gears or motor. If the mirror feels unusually stiff, inspect it for ice, dirt, or mechanical damage before attempting to move it by hand.

Where is the power folding mirror fuse located?

The fuse location depends on the model year and trim level of your GMC Sierra. In most vehicles, the mirror fuse is located inside the interior fuse box or the underhood fuse block. The exact fuse number can be found in the owner’s manual or on the fuse box diagram. If the replacement fuse blows immediately after installation, further diagnosis is required because an underlying electrical fault is likely present.

Can a weak battery affect power folding mirrors?

Yes. Power folding mirrors rely on stable system voltage to operate correctly. A weak battery or failing charging system may not supply enough electrical power for the mirror motors, resulting in slow operation, incomplete folding, or intermittent performance. If other electrical accessories are also behaving abnormally, testing the battery and charging system should be part of the diagnostic process.

Will disconnecting the battery reset the mirrors?

Disconnecting the battery can clear temporary software glitches in some GMC Sierra models. After reconnecting the battery, the mirrors may require recalibration by completing several full folding and unfolding cycles. Although this procedure may resolve minor electronic issues, it will not repair damaged motors, broken actuators, faulty wiring, or defective control modules.

Can cold weather stop power folding mirrors from working?

Absolutely. Snow, ice, and freezing temperatures can prevent the mirror pivot from moving freely. When ice locks the mechanism in place, the motor may hum, click, or stop without moving the mirror. Avoid forcing frozen mirrors open by hand. Instead, allow the ice to melt naturally or use an automotive-safe de-icing product before operating the folding function.

How much does it cost to replace a GMC Sierra power folding mirror?

Replacement costs vary depending on the truck’s model year and equipment level. A complete OEM power folding mirror assembly generally costs between $350 and $900, while premium towing mirrors with integrated cameras, blind spot monitoring, and memory functions can exceed $1,000 including labor. Replacing only the mirror motor or actuator is often less expensive if those parts are available separately.

Can I replace a power folding mirror myself?

Many experienced DIY enthusiasts can replace a mirror assembly using basic hand tools. The process usually involves removing the interior door trim, disconnecting the electrical connector, removing the mounting fasteners, and installing the replacement mirror. However, vehicles equipped with advanced electronic features may require calibration or programming after installation. If your truck has memory mirrors, surround-view cameras, or blind spot monitoring, professional installation may be the better option.

How can I prevent power folding mirror problems?

Routine maintenance is the best way to extend the life of your mirrors. Clean the hinge area regularly, lubricate the pivot with silicone spray, remove road salt during winter, inspect the door wiring for wear, and avoid forcing frozen mirrors to move. Performing these simple maintenance tasks can significantly reduce wear on the motor and actuator while helping prevent expensive repairs.
